Any idea why the front ones blew twice? I'm curious about that.
bills
May 6 2005, 02:34 PM
Koni 2x adj shocks are really race only units. they are just not made for daily use. GM had a ton of warranty claims on the 1LE cars, here in the NorthEast. It is not just the F-Body, A Friends Miata 2xadj konis just died again. the single adjs seem to last fine. The fun part is that koni will fix the singles, but call them with a double that has died and they fight you. I got the shocks fixed once for free, then they wanted 300 to fix them a second time, both times the seals let go and then the whole shock died
